Discover more about Dubuque Shot Tower

The Dubuque Shot Tower stands as a testament to the rich history and industrial heritage of Dubuque, Iowa. Constructed in 1856, this historic structure was originally used for manufacturing lead shot. The tower rises prominently against the skyline, reaching a height of 120 feet, making it one of the tallest shot towers in the United States. As you approach, take a moment to appreciate the unique architecture that has withstood the test of time, featuring a circular design that is both functional and aesthetically pleasing. Visitors can explore the surrounding area, which is home to a variety of parks and scenic viewpoints that enhance the overall experience. The location offers a chance to not only admire the tower itself but also to soak in the picturesque views of the Mississippi River and the city of Dubuque. The significance of the Dubuque Shot Tower extends beyond its physical structure; it represents a pivotal era in the region's development during the industrial revolution. As you delve deeper into its history, you'll discover how this site played a crucial role in the local economy and the evolution of manufacturing practices. The nearby interpretive signs provide insightful information about the tower's operation and its impact on the community.
